Insertar informacion desde una pagina web

Solo disponible en BuenasTareas
  • Páginas : 2 (476 palabras )
  • Descarga(s) : 0
  • Publicado : 7 de octubre de 2010
Leer documento completo
Vista previa del texto
COMO INSERTAR INFORMACION DESDE UNA PAGINA WEB A UNA BAS E DE DATOS POSTGRESQL CON JAVA (JSP).

PRIMERO CREAMOS UNA PAGINA WEB CON UN CAMPO DE TEXTO:

[pic]

La pagina debe tener un botonGuardar.

En html debemos tener encuenta lo siguiente:

El campo de texto debe tener un nombre alusivo a lo que representa

Codigo html del campo de texto

Codigo html del boton Guardar

El camponombre y el botón Guardar deben estar dentro de una etiqueta llamada form.

Nombre





// se cierra la etiqueta

¿Cual es la función de la etiqueta form?. Esta etiqueta es utilizadapara poder enviar información a través de internet. En el ejemplo si damos clic en el botón guardar, todos los objetos o campos que estén dentro de la etiqueta serán enviados a la páginainsertar_usu.jsp, la cual debe estar en el valor de action.

[pic]

String nombre=request.getParameter("nombre");

NOTA: NO OLVIDAR QUE UNA PAGINA jsp es la mezcla de codigo java con html.

Para mezclarcodigo java con html se necesita que el codigo java este dentro de la siguientes etiquetas

ejemplo.

El resto de codigo java ya todos lo conocen es el mismo utilizado en clases anterioresConnection conexion;
Statement sentencia;

ResultSet resultado;
String usu="";
boolean existe=false;

System.out.println( "Iniciando programa." );

// Se carga el driverJDBC-ODBC

try {

Class.forName( "org.postgresql.Driver" );
System.out.println( "cargo el driver" );

}

catch( Exception e ) {

System.out.println("No se pudo cargar el puente JDBC-ODBC." );

return; }

try {//iniciar insercion

// Se establece la conexión con la base de datos

conexion =DriverManager.getConnection( "jdbc:postgresql://localhost/senasolucion","root","admin1234");

sentencia = conexion.createStatement();

resultado=sentencia.executeQuery("SELECT usuario FROM usuario WHERE...
tracking img